Output 15603c920f708ade74d85f684377805d75993b78c5ef8f6b960edf608c25ba63:1

value
347748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a3ffdae89fbf1a81367922cf88c38fbb6ab382c OP_EQUAL
address
3CqR27fvbN4mCQUiNWHjKAjhctZcmZa9Ls
transaction
15603c920f708ade74d85f684377805d75993b78c5ef8f6b960edf608c25ba63
spent
true